Output 8587fd0483880eddf7e29bc45d853406f4dc79df0f331a9738bb3eb7176cab0a:0

value
831634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ca801b953849df5cc8cc62bb0b72dd5b61a4dd3 OP_EQUAL
address
3A8wMWE1jXC25XLnkMdu91722kn4Cr54Bn
transaction
8587fd0483880eddf7e29bc45d853406f4dc79df0f331a9738bb3eb7176cab0a
confirmations
280263
spent
true